3. Types of Mortgage Refinancing

  • Rate-and-Term Refinance: Changing interest rates or loan terms.
  • Cash-Out Refinance: Accessing equity for home improvements or debt consolidation.
  • Streamline Refinancing: Specifically for VA and FHA loans.
